0
我需要執行外部Java應用程序作爲Gradle構建過程的一部分。外部應用程序在其類路徑中需要與應用程序Gradle構建的JAR相同的JAR。有什麼方法可以將我在Gradle中定義的依賴關係公開給外部應用程序嗎?我可以使用Gradle構建類路徑字符串
即我需要運行此:
java -jar -cp [jars from Gradle] myapp.jar
我需要執行外部Java應用程序作爲Gradle構建過程的一部分。外部應用程序在其類路徑中需要與應用程序Gradle構建的JAR相同的JAR。有什麼方法可以將我在Gradle中定義的依賴關係公開給外部應用程序嗎?我可以使用Gradle構建類路徑字符串
即我需要運行此:
java -jar -cp [jars from Gradle] myapp.jar
你可以簡單的任務添加到您的構建來獲得所產生的類路徑。
task printClasspath << {
println configurations.runtime.asPath
}
Thankyou。這正是我需要的。 – Phyxx 2014-09-24 22:20:42
您能否澄清一下情況? – Opal 2014-09-24 20:15:37